Timber Dispatch Coordinator Courses in Port Macquarie

A Timber Dispatch Coordinator schedules and coordinates timber deliveries, liaises with customers and drivers, manages paperwork, and ensures orders are correct.

In Australia, a full time Timber Dispatch Coordinator generally earns $1,250 per week ($65,000 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

The number of people working in this industry has grown moderately over the last five years. There are currently 5,200 people employed in the timber processing industry in Australia and many of them specialise as a Timber Dispatch Coordinator. Timber Dispatch Coordinators may find work in regions of Australia where timber processing facilities are located.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

A Certificate III in Timber Building Products Supply (Logistics) is an ideal qualification if you’re interested in a career as a Timber Dispatch Coordinator. This course covers a range of topics including onsite safety and communication, environmental procedures, completing dispatch documents, ensuring safety of transport activities, operating forklifts and loading cranes and driving trucks and rigid vehicles.
